VISION FOR ECO-SCHOOLS AT BELL FARM
The Eco Club and Environmental Awareness curriculum at Bell Farm aims to promote a sense of responsibility for the natural world and to foster awareness of the impact we as humans have on our natural environment. Because Bell Farm places significant emphasis on teaching values, it is vital that Bell Farm students understand their connection to the planet and are equipped with a range of realistic strategies with which to affect positive change where environmental issues are concerned.
In addition to an extensive Outdoor Learning curriculum, we have a student-led “Eco Warrior Council” that consists of students from Years 2-6. Participation in this group not only empowers our pupils by offering opportunities for forming leadership, teamwork and communication skills, but it also places our school in a position to have a positive impact on the greater community.
At Bell Farm, environmental awareness topics are written into the curriculum in every year group and we integrate age-appropriate environmental teaching into lessons when opportunities present themselves. Additionally, we hold large-scale projects that involve the entire school in environmental awareness— for example a recent school-wide bottle top collection enabled every class to take part in the creation of a fabulous mural that now hangs proudly in our hall.
